six easy steps to better hearing

Over the first days and weeks of using your hearing instruments, you will experience
sounds that will be new to you, especially if you have not previously worn hearing
instruments. Experiment with listening to these new or long-forgotten sounds.
1. In the quiet of your home
Try to acclimate yourself to all the new sounds. Listen to the many background sounds
and try to identify each sound. Bear in mind that some sounds will seem different or
unusual to you. You may have to learn to re-identify them. Note that in time you will
become accustomed to the sounds in your environment – if you experience problems,
please contact your Hearing Care Professional.
If using your hearing instruments make you tired, remove it for a short time, and take a
rest. Gradually you will begin to be able to listen for longer periods of time, and soon you
will be able to wear your hearing instruments comfortably all day long.
